Neale Donald Walsch is the famous author of ‘Conversations with God’. In this book Relationships: Applications for Living, he talks about human relationships. And more specifically a man-woman relationship and relationship that people call marriage. He talks mostly about his personal experiences. The relationship that he shares with his wife and the woman that he dated before he met his wife.

I honestly did not find anything new in the book. It is all about letting the other person be themselves and allowing yourself to be yourself with your partner. Well if you can practically do that, if you can let go of all the walls between the two of you, you can actually have the ideal relationship. But ideal things exist in the ideal world. Also, we have been conditioned from the time we are born about certain human behaviors, which I think is the biggest barrier to human relationships. This conditioning does not let us be ourselves even when we are alone. Let alone in the presence of anyone else.

I like a few quotes in the book, and which I kind of believe in:

  • Living with you is like living alone
  • My will for you is your will for you
  • Sometimes goodness (mate) comes to you in packages that are quite unexpected
  • The words Joy, Love, and Freedom are interchangeable

It’s a small 80-page book that you can read if you like the message in the above quotes.

Published in 1999, it is a part of the Applications for Living series, that includes books on abundance, right livelihood, and holistic living.

In this book, the author Walsch explores the nature of relationships and how they can be used to help us grow and evolve spiritually. He argues that relationships are a mirror for our soul and that they provide us with the opportunity to learn and heal.

Divided into three parts:

  • Purpose of relationships and how they can help us to know ourselves better.
  • Explores the different types of relationships that we have, and how we can improve them.
  • Discusses how to create healthy and fulfilling relationships.

A practical and inspiring guide to understanding and improving our relationships. A valuable resource for anyone who wants to create more love, joy, and peace in their life.

Key takeaways:

Relationships

  • Are a mirror for our souls. They reflect back to us our strengths, weaknesses, and areas for growth.
  • Provide us with the opportunity to learn and heal. They can help us to let go of old pain and resentments, and to open our hearts to love.
  • Different types of relationships, each with its own unique purpose. The most important ones in our lives include romantic, friendships, family, and with ourselves.
  • Create healthy and fulfilling relationships by being honest, open, and loving. Learn to communicate effectively, to set boundaries, and to resolve conflict peacefully.
